Orange County Joins SoCal Pizza Week for Culinary Celebration
Exciting Opportunity to Support Local Pizzerias
Orange County, California – A delicious initiative is unfolding as fourteen local pizzerias participate in the inaugural SoCal Pizza Week, taking place from February 8 to 15, 2026. This week-long culinary celebration coincides with National Pizza Day on February 9 and aims to uplift and support local pizza establishments across Southern California. With an emphasis on community involvement and dining choice, SoCal Pizza Week encourages residents and visitors alike to explore the diverse pizza offerings within their neighborhoods.

Event Overview
SoCal Pizza Week is orchestrated by SoCal Food & Beverage, a nonprofit dedicated to promoting local restaurants through engaging culinary events. Featuring over 40 participating pizzerias from Los Angeles, San Diego, and Orange County, the week will showcase a broad spectrum of pizza styles, including wood-fired, hand-tossed, deep dish, and Sicilian. This diversity ensures that there is something for everyone, regardless of taste preferences.
Participating Orange County Pizzerias
The following fourteen pizzerias in Orange County will celebrate SoCal Pizza Week:
- Cruiser’s Pizza Bar Grill
- Beachwood Pizza & Beer
- Riip Pizza
- Nardo Italian Restaurant
- Loosies Pizza
- Santo’s Pizza
- Foretti’s
- Stadium Pepz Pizza & Eatery
- Trenta Pizza & Cucina
- 2145 Eats
- The Pizza Store
- Gibroni’s Pizza
- Pitfire Pizza
- Terra Mia Pizzeria
These establishments are set to offer special deals ranging from $5 to $25, incentivizing diners to discover new neighborhoods and support their local businesses. This promotion not only benefits the restaurants but also allows participants to experience the rich culinary fabric of their community.
Participating in the Golden Slice Awards
During SoCal Pizza Week, attendees will also have the chance to participate in the Golden Slice Awards. Diners can cast their votes for their favorite pizzas in categories such as “Best Cheese Pizza,” “Best Neapolitan Pizza,” and “Best Specialty Pizza.” This friendly competition not only adds an engaging element to the event but also showcases the exceptional quality and variety of pizza available in the region.
Background and Impact of SoCal Food & Beverage
SoCal Food & Beverage has a proven track record of promoting local dining experiences through events like Taco Week and Burger Week. The introduction of SoCal Pizza Week illustrates a growing appreciation for Southern California’s vibrant pizza scene and the desire to highlight the skills of local pizza makers. By spotlighting individual establishments, the community celebrates its diverse culinary landscape while nurturing local entrepreneurship.
